Sokoman Minerals (CVE:SIC) Trading 5.3% Higher   – Time to Buy?

Sokoman Minerals Corp. shares rose 5.3% to C$0.20 on Friday (from a C$0.19 close), trading as high as C$0.20 on only 101,707 shares — an 84% drop from its average daily volume of 648,583 — suggesting the move occurred on light liquidity. The stock is trading above its 50-day (C$0.17) and 200-day (C$0.08) moving averages, sports a market capitalization of C$88.43 million, a negative P/E of -19.5 and a beta of 2.79, and the company remains an exploration-stage gold miner with 100% ownership of the Moosehead, Crippleback Lake and district-scale Fleur de Lys projects in Newfoundland.

Analysis

Sokoman Minerals shares rose 5.3% to C$0.20 on Friday (from C$0.19), trading as high as C$0.20 on only 101,707 shares — an 84% decline from its average daily volume of 648,583 — indicating the price move occurred on materially lighter liquidity than typical. The stock sits above both its 50-day (C$0.17) and 200-day (C$0.08) moving averages, which signals short- and medium-term technical strength, while the sentiment signal is mildly positive (0.12). The company is an exploration-stage gold explorer with 100% ownership of Moosehead, Crippleback Lake and the district-scale Fleur de Lys projects in Newfoundland; market capitalization is C$88.43 million, P/E is negative at -19.50 and beta is elevated at 2.79, underscoring operating losses and above-market volatility. Given the exploration-stage profile, valuation metrics are limited and near-term returns are likely driven by project newsflow and liquidity rather than fundamental earnings. The combination of light volume on the uptick, technicals above moving averages and high beta implies moves may be short-lived without confirming catalysts such as drilling results or corporate announcements; risk remains binary and idiosyncratic. Investors should treat the recent pop as noise absent higher-volume confirmation and monitor project-specific developments closely.
